Distinguishing between invasive urothelial carcinoma (UC) from other genitourinary malignancies, such as prostatic and renal carcinomas, can be difficult. Several new markers such as GATA binding protein 3 (GATA-3), S100P, and uroplakin III have been developed for this differentiation (1-7). More recently uroplakin II has been introduced (1-7). Uroplakin II is a 15 kDa protein component of urothelial plaques, which enhance the permeability barrier of the urothelium. 15 Uroplakin II [BC21] is a highly specific antibody that may be useful in identifying tumors of urothelial origin.
Topoisomerase II alpha (Topo IIa) plays an important role in DNA synthesis and RNA transcription, as well as chromosomal segregation during mitosis. This is a monoclonal antibody to the A-subunit of human coagulation Factor XIII. Studies have shown it recognizes human Factor XIII Achain in both reduced and non-reduced forms.
